Fortune Harbour

Fortune Harbour is located in Newfoundland and Labrador
Fortune Harbour
Fortune Harbour
Location of Fortune Harbour in Newfoundland and Labrador

Fortune Harbour or Fortune Harbor is a designated place in the Canadian province of Newfoundland and Labrador.